The Appeal

The introduction of the MkV marked an important chapter in Jaguar's history. It was their first car to feature independent front suspension, the first with hydraulic brakes and the first to employ aerodynamic fender 'spats' over the rear wheels. It shared a stand at the October 1948 London Motor Show with the all-new XK120, which stole the limelight yet sold far fewer cars year-on-year.

We're excited to bring to market this very rare variant of the MkV, one of just 685 Drophead Coupé models ever made. Originally produced for a showroom in Wellington, New Zealand, this vehicle has travelled to Malibu, California, before arriving in Poland. It underwent a comprehensive restoration in 2019 and an engine overhaul in 2024.

The Mechanics

  • 3.5-litre pushrod straight-six
  • Four-speed manual gearbox
  • Engine produces 125 hp in factory tune
